Key Features

Diameter: 6 mm

Length: 10 mm

Material: 100Cr6, AISI52100, SUJ2

Tolerance: m6 or as per requirement

Heat treatment: Hardened and tempered to HRC 58~62

Example Uses

Alignment and Positioning: The primary use of a dowel pin like the 6×10 is for accurately aligning two components. They are inserted into corresponding holes in two parts that need to be positioned relative to each other. For example, in mechanical assemblies or in machinery, they ensure that parts remain in a fixed, precise alignment during assembly, use, or operation.

Component Joining: Dowel pins also help in joining parts together. For example, in a housing assembly, dowel pins can be used to join two parts and prevent shifting.

Guide Pin for Moving Parts: In machines or fixtures with moving parts, a 6×10 dowel pin can serve as a guide to maintain consistent travel and precise alignment of those parts.

Fixtures and Tooling: In fixtures or tooling used for machining or assembly, the 6×10 dowel pin can help set the exact positioning of components, ensuring repeatability and precision in the manufacturing process.
